Enbridge Inc. 8-K Summary: 2025 Annual Meeting Results
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 8-K reports the results of the 2025 Annual Meeting of Shareholders for Enbridge Inc., held on May 7, 2025. The filing details the outcomes of three specific matters submitted to a vote by security holders.
Key Financial Metrics
This filing does not contain financial performance data such as rev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, debt, or liquidity. The document is strictly a report on shareholder voting results.
Material Changes and Voting Outcomes
The following matters were voted upon and approved by shareholders:
- Election of Directors: All 12 nominees were elected to the Board. Support ranged from 91.57% for Steven W. Williams to 99.68% for Douglas L. Foshee. Broker non-votes were approximately 193.58 million shares for each nominee.
- Appointment of Auditors: Shareholders approved the appointment of PricewaterhouseCoopers LLP as the independent auditor. The proposal received 91.42% of votes cast (1,291,806,869 votes for).
- Advisory Vote on Executive Compensation ("Say on Pay"): Shareholders accepted the company's approach to executive compensation. The proposal received 89.78% of votes cast (1,094,891,923 votes for).
